Transaction 23cb74aa104fd8cb7727192138cc5d275babf0c93a579e455d86a1cad716bbda
1 Input
1 Output
-
23cb74aa104fd8cb7727192138cc5d275babf0c93a579e455d86a1cad716bbda:0
- value
- 12777114
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c4ec042b9b1929b4fa5335f340027b4545c1f1d
- address
- bc1qd38vqs4ekxffkna9xd0ngqp8k329c8cax0ks3a